Basketball shutouts are quite rare, but they do sometimes happen. These are virtually restricted to high school and amateur level. In the United States, high ranked schools are frequently seeded to play low-ranked schools, and the lopsidedness becomes quite clear. Mats Wermelin once scored all points in a 272-0 shutout in a high school game in Sweden on February 6, 1974. Also, a Michigan high school girls basketball team lost 61-0 to the third-ranked team in the state in 2004. Around the same time in the DC area, Eleanor Roosevelt (girls) beat Cardozo 108-0!

A middle school basketball hoop is the same height as a professional hoop. A height of 10 feet is used for every level of basketball, except for some pee-wee/elementary leagues that use 8 feet.
